Photons from NIR LEDs can delay flowering in short-day soybean and Cannabis: Implications for phytochrome activity.
Photons during the dark period delay flowering in short-day plants (SDP). Red photons applied at night convert phytochromes to the active far-red absorbing form (Pfr), leading to inhibition of flowering.
